4,700 enroll for Guyana digital ID ahead of full rollout

More than 4,700 citizens have registered for Guyana’s national electronic identification (eID) system in 2025, receiving a single identifier and completing biometric verification supplied by Veridos.
The country’s national digital ID system is developed by the Digital Identity Card Registry.
This includes a person’s name, address, national ID number, passport number, Taxpayer Identification Number (TIN), photograph, driver’s licence, marriage certificate, birth certificate and deed poll documentation.
Citizens are invited to submit documents to enrollment stations, where officials can capture their facial biometrics and fingerprints for the eID card.
